Bill, I've been out to Darby Wetlands 4 times in the last couple months, and
I had not seen a Great Blue Heron there either- until yesterday, Nov. 3rd. 
One flew from the west and landed in the pond.  Lots of coots, and smaller
amounts of Yellowlegs and peeps were around.

I haven't seen any gulls there either, but back in September I saw 4 Caspian
Terns standing in shallow water- a life bird for this landlubber :)  Photo
available upon request!
